sap

【MM系列】SAP MM模块-委外采购订单 把Warning转换成Error信息提示

匿名 (未验证) 提交于 2019-12-02 23:47:01
公众号: SAP Technical 本文作者: matinal 原文出处: http://www.cnblogs.com/SAPmatinal/ 原文链接: 【MM系列】SAP MM模块-委外采购订单 把Warning转换成Error信息提示 前言部分 大家可以关注我的公众号,公众号里的排版更好,阅读更舒适。 正文部分 我们现在的委外采购订单行项目,如果手工不输入“L",只会出现黄色警告提示,我想把他修改成红色错误提示,该如何修改配置呢? 对于由于交期不满足而提示的黄色警告信息也会一起被调整成红色错误提示吗? 答案:你可以用t-code OME0 去设置把Warning信息提示转换成Error信息提示! 转载请注明,谢谢。

SAP Kyma和SAP云平台上的Service instance - 452

匿名 (未验证) 提交于 2019-12-02 23:43:01
两种instance都需要绑定到具体的应用或者函数才能发挥作用。 # SAP Kyma ![clipboard1](https://user-images.githubusercontent.com/5669954/50592654-03212100-0ed0-11e9-993c-ed32e7dc25e7.png) ![clipboard2](https://user-images.githubusercontent.com/5669954/50592656-03b9b780-0ed0-11e9-96d3-f07c4ad59d91.png) 这个GATEWAY_URL的值可以在Kyma Lambda函数实现里通过环境变量的方式获得。 ![clipboard3](https://user-images.githubusercontent.com/5669954/50592657-03b9b780-0ed0-11e9-9879-7564e5d1f890.png) 在JavaScript代码里的语法就是${process.env.GATEWAY_URL}, 做过nodejs开发的朋友不会觉得陌生。 ![clipboard4](https://user-images.githubusercontent.com/5669954/50592659-03b9b780-0ed0-11e9-8286

SAP MM模块相关透明表收集

匿名 (未验证) 提交于 2019-12-02 23:40:02
物料表 MCHA 批次表(批次、评估类型 工厂物料) MARA 查看物料数据(发票名称、创建时间、人员) MARC 物料数据查询(利润中心、状态、在途) MAKT 查看物料描述 MKPF 物料抬头 MSPR 物料数据(库存冻结、特殊库存) MVKE 物料编码(销售组织 分销渠道) T134 物料类型表 T149 估价表 T149D评估类 T149B 评估类型表 T023T物料组 (物料组描述1物料组描述2) Mseg 物资凭证 (采购订单、物资凭证、预留) MBSM 查看两物料凭证是否冲销(通过SE16下执行M_MBMPS) OMBT 查看物料凭证间隔 库存表 MCHB 库存表 MCHBH 历史库存表 MARD以及MBEW 导各工厂下的未清限制库存能让及冻结库存 MBEW物料金额 MARD库存地(查看所有库存地) MAOL 库存地(非寄售库存及删除标记查询) S031查看期间收发库存 工厂表 T001L工厂和库存地表对应关系 T001W工厂表 T001E公司表 T001K评估公司表 T006A计量单位描述 RESB导各工厂下的未清预留1 RESB 预留查看 RKPF 预留抬头表 T156 移动类型表 T156*所有移动类型关系表 T156X 移动类型科目修改 采购表 项目明细表 抬头明细表 供应商表 LIKP 查看交货清单 KNB1 KNA1查找客户供应商表 (客户表) LFA1

C#连接SAP HANA数据库读取数据

匿名 (未验证) 提交于 2019-12-02 23:37:01
版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/ot512csdn/article/details/90751158 SAP PO中间件系统,使用的SAP HANA数据库,平台上数据交换日志都写到BC_MSG_LOG这张表里, 但PO的管理界面提供的功能很弱,无法基于这张表的数据做多维度的统计和展示。 如果我们想做一些指标的展示,例如下面,我们需要在HANA数据库中自己读出这张表的数据。 C#对数据库的操作当然应该是用微软的EF框架,效率超高。 可惜HANA才推出不久,配套的微软EF框架还没出来。 那就先用ODBC试试: 一、在SAP官网下载HANA的client安装包(其中包含C#开发类库) HDB_CLIENT_WINDOWS_X86_64_20190112.zip 安装完成后要重启动WIN10系统,然后ODBC里面才能看到HANA的驱动。 二、在系统ODBC里面,配一个连接出来。 三、打开VS2017,建一个WINFORM桌面程序,全部代码如下: (注意项目用64位程序编译才能通过) using System; using System.Collections.Generic; using System.ComponentModel; using System.Data; using System.Data.Odbc;

SAP WM 确定WM移动类型配置里'存储地点参考'优先级高于'特殊移动标记'

匿名 (未验证) 提交于 2019-12-02 23:36:01
SAP WM 确定WM移动类型配置里'存储地点参考'优先级高于'特殊移动标记' 我们有定义如下的storage location reference: 在如下的Assign WM movement type的配置里, 收货到1003,如果不输入特殊移动标记,则WM层面的移动类型,根据storage location reference 13,能找到113这个移动类型。 如果使用MIGO+101移动类型,加上特殊移动标记K,对工单执行收货到1003存储地的时候,SAP会找到哪个WM的移动类型,是113还是923? 如下process order 成品完工入库收货地是1003. SAP里MIGO+101,使用特殊移动标记K(预计的WM移动类型923), MIGO+101 with K, 观察SAP是确定哪个WM移动类型: Post, 看其WM单据, WM movement type 是113,而非923! 也就是说在storage location reference和special movement indicator同时存在的时候,确定WM移动类型的配置里,storage location reference优先级更高! 2017-03-09 写于苏州市吴中区 SAP WM 确定WM移动类型配置里'存储地点参考'优先级高于'特殊移动标记' 文章来源: https://blog

BTE增强

匿名 (未验证) 提交于 2019-12-02 23:34:01
转自 https://www.cnblogs.com/Garfield/p/5313962.html Enhancement(1)--BTEs 最近一个同事碰到一个FI的增强,要用BTEs实现,我也是第一次接触到这种增强,所以跟着他一起做了一下。写一个这方面的小节。 由于采用这种技术架构,SAP就使这些接口,分为Made by SAP, Made by SAP's Partner, Made by SAP's Customer,三方可以个取所需。 T-code: FIBF 进入BTEs的界面 Environment->Infosystem(Processes)->运行->Process 00001120->Sample function module, 然后复制这个function到自己的Z或Y程序中->编辑新复制的程序,加入自己的代码 回到FIFB界面,Settings->Products->...of customer->New Entries加入自己的product,并激活 回到FIFB界面,Settings->Process Modules->... of customer->新建主键是 00001120的Process,并将刚才建立的function module和product写到相应栏位。 Enhancement(2)--Dictionary Elements

SAP 获取批次信息函数(MSC3N)

匿名 (未验证) 提交于 2019-12-02 23:34:01
在SAP系统中一般通过tcode-MSC3N来查看批次信息 而要在ABAP程序中获取批次信息则需要调用两个函数: VB_BATCH_2_CLASS_OBJECT BAPI_OBJCL_GETDETAIL 将这两个函数串联使用即可 VB_BATCH_2_CLASS_OBJECT: BAPI_OBJCL_GETDETAIL: CHARACT_DESCR 为批次信息的描述 VALVE_FROM Ϊ F 类型的值 'VB_BATCH_2_CLASS_OBJECT' EXPORTING BESTAND - MATNR BESTAND - CHARG BESTAND - WERKS IMPORTING E_OBJEK E_OBTAB E_KLART E_CLASS . CLEAR . CLEAR . CLEAR . 'BAPI_OBJCL_GETDETAIL' EXPORTING E_OBJEK E_OBTAB E_CLASS E_KLART TABLES ALLOCVALUESNUM[] ALLOCVALUESCHAR[] ALLOCVALUESCURR[] RETURN[] . 值得注意的是如果 SAP 的物料号配置为 18 为则 BAPI_OBJCL_GETDETAIL 的调用中要使用 OBJECTKEY 参数二入股物料号配置为40位则需要使用 OBJECTKEY_LONG 参数

BASIS小问题汇总1

匿名 (未验证) 提交于 2019-12-02 23:32:01
try to start SAP system 2019-04-04 Symptom: when i tried to start SAP system, using the command: sapcontrol -nr 60 -function InstanceStart PRDERPAS01 60 and I get the below failed information: FAIL: NIECONN_REFUSED (Connecion refused), NiRawConnect failed in plugin_fopen() Reason: The issue you had was related to sapstartsrv, which was not running. use following command to check sapstartsrv ps -ef | grep sapstartsrv Resolution: Once it was started: /usr/sap/ / /exe/sapstartsrv pf=/usr/sap/ /SYS/profile/ -D -u /usr/sap/S4P/D61/exe/sapstartsrv pf=/usr/sap/S4P/SYS/profile/S4P_D61_PRDERPAP01 -D -u